Output 6f89a99a29531edb990deedd787e3af1e40e0db9aefe16dce1d1b2be38227838:0

value
81332
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b4a6ca85fd509235a573d87e7933a4bd01ec83d OP_EQUALVERIFY OP_CHECKSIG
address
14wuDMHYbVKD4TLDvBPUkPAgUMyyhsQWe3
transaction
6f89a99a29531edb990deedd787e3af1e40e0db9aefe16dce1d1b2be38227838
spent
true